Jollof rice is a dish originally from what continent?

A. South America
B. Africa
C. Asia
D. Europe

Final answer:

Jollof rice is a traditional dish from the continent of Africa, specifically linked to West African culinary traditions that developed alongside its agriculture, such as the domestication of yams and rice.

Step-by-step explanation:

Jollof rice is a dish originally from Africa. This dish is closely associated with the cultures and cuisines of West Africa, where agriculture was developed by the domestication of plants such as yams and rice. The region was also heavily involved in the Trans-Atlantic slave trade, which had a profound impact on the culture and food practices, with Jollof rice being one of the dishes that reflects the rich agricultural and culinary traditions of West Africa.
